Output 85c8a7c44799c9fb00a101d2a638b588c0b38312e88fa3b832afc11f3e4f6aa2:0

value
6351
script pubkey
OP_0 OP_PUSHBYTES_20 ef5899c50e5c1331b178da5f632b75904bae408a
address
bc1qaavfn3gwtsfnrvtcmf0kx2m4jp96usy2sfrquy
transaction
85c8a7c44799c9fb00a101d2a638b588c0b38312e88fa3b832afc11f3e4f6aa2
confirmations
175864
spent
true